MAGA Allies Propose Banning Pregnant Foreign Women from Entering the US

Africa17 hr ago

Following the Supreme Court's decision to uphold the "birthright citizenship" rule, allies of former President Donald Trump associated with the MAGA movement have proposed barring pregnant foreign women from entering the United States. This idea emerges as a response to the established principle that any child born on American soil is granted U.S. citizenship. The proposal aims to prevent non-citizens from entering the country specifically to give birth and thereby obtain citizenship for their children. The MAGA movement's focus on immigration control appears to extend to this specific demographic, seeking to curb perceived abuses of the birthright citizenship policy.
